What are the major energy companies in Cuba?
UNE (Unión Eléctrica) is responsible for the generation, transmission, distribution, and commercialization of electrical energy. CUPET (Unión Cuba-Petróleo) is the state-owned oil firm and Cuba's largest oil company. Other companies operating in Cuba's energy sector include Energas, Inter RAO, Zerus, Havana Energy, and Siemens.

What drives the outdoor power equipment market?
The outdoor power equipment market is driven by the rapid growth of construction industry. With global surge in construction activities, outdoor power equipment like landscaping tools, compact utility loaders and portable generators are also increasingly demanded by people.

How is the outdoor power equipment market segmented?
Based on power, the outdoor power equipment market is segmented into electric, and fuel based. The electric segment is anticipated to register a CAGR of over 6.5% from 2024 to 2032.
